Output bb27aac0124a0ece839feee04f5e5b030d5d323bdfcfa9d1998a8a6386176b94:1

value
15638848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f9bd9857f46f379074c4203bc6cf10cc0b OP_EQUAL
address
3BMEX6hEbvdDg1m6geL7QffA5EuUhxjUF8
transaction
bb27aac0124a0ece839feee04f5e5b030d5d323bdfcfa9d1998a8a6386176b94
confirmations
379272
spent
true